Flashcards

Cytokinesis

The final stage of cell division where the cytoplasm divides, creating two daughter cells.

Cleavage Furrow

In animal cells, the cell membrane pinches inward, forming a cleavage furrow that eventually divides the cell into two.

Cell Plate

In plant cells, a new cell wall forms between the two daughter cells, called a cell plate.

Organelle Distribution

Both new daughter cells receive approximately half of the original cell's cytoplasm and organelles.

Study Notes

Cytokinesis

  • Cytokinesis is a phase of the cell cycle where the cytoplasm divides.
  • Each new cell receives about half of the cell's cytoplasm and organelles.
  • In animal cells, the cell membrane pinches inward and forms two cells.
  • In plant cells, a cell plate forms a midline of the dividing cells.
